CHAIRMAN BOARD OF GOVERNORS ASVTC
- As Chairman of the Board, ensures the Board of Governors fulfils its responsibilities for the governance of the organization.
- Partners with the principal, helping him/her to achieve the mission of the organization.
- Optimizes the relationship between the Board and management.
The Chairman shall preside at all meetings of the Board of Governors, be an ex officio member of all committees, except the Elections Committee, have general and management control of program affairs subject to approval of the Board of Governors, ensure that all orders and resolutions of the Board of Governors are effected, appoint such committee chairs as may be required and sign or countersign all certificates, contracts or other documents, as authorized by the Board of Governors.
- Chairs the meetings of the Board of Governors. See that it functions effectively, interacts with management optimally, and fulfils all of its duties. With the Board of Directors develop agendas.
- With the Board of Directors recommend composition of the Board of Governors. Recommend committee chairperson with an eye to future succession.
- Reflects any concerns management has in regard to the role of the Board of Governors or individual Governors. Reflect to the Board of Directors the concerns of the Board of Governors and other constituencies.
- Annually focuses the Board's attention on matters of organizational governance that relate to its own structure, role, and relationship to management. Ensure the Board is satisfied it has fulfilled all of its responsibilities.
- Draft annual budget before 1st October for approval by the Board of Directors
- Serves as the organization’s spokesperson.
